בית חומרה מהו זיכרון טרניארי הניתן לניתוק-תוכן (tcam)? - הגדרה מטכנולוגיה

מהו זיכרון טרניארי הניתן לניתוק-תוכן (tcam)? - הגדרה מטכנולוגיה

תוכן עניינים:

Anonim

הגדרה - מה הפירוש של זיכרון הניתן לטיפול במגע Ternary (TCAM)?

זיכרון Ternary content-adressable (TCAM) הוא סוג של זיכרון הניתן להתייחסות תוכן (CAM) המאפשר מצב שלישי של "לא אכפת" או "X" באחת או יותר מקטעי הנתונים המאוחסנים, מה שמוסיף גמישות ל לחפש. המילה "ternary" מתייחסת למספר התשומות שהזיכרון יכול לאחסן ולשאול: 0, 1 ו- X או כרטיס בר. מצד שני, מצלמות רשת בינאריות יכולות לבצע שאילתות באמצעות 1 ו - 0 בלבד.

Techopedia מסביר זיכרון Ternary Content-Addressable (TCAM)

זיכרון הניתן להתייחסות טרנרית הוא סוג של CAM שנחשב להיפך מ- RAM מכיוון שהוא אינו ניגש לנתונים באותה דרך, על ידי מתן כתובת זיכרון ספציפית למקום בו הנתונים מאוחסנים. אך ניתן לגשת לנתונים המאוחסנים ב- CAM רק על ידי שאילתת הנתונים הספציפיים הנדרשים ואז ה- CAM מאחזר את הכתובות בהן נשמרים הנתונים השאילתה. CAM משמש לאחסון וחיפוש על נתונים באורך קבוע, מה שהופך אותו למושלם לאחסון כתובות MAC מכיוון שלאלה יש אורך קבוע. זה גם מהיר יותר מ- RAM מכיוון שהוא מאפשר חיפוש מקביל.

CAM רגיל או CAM בינארי יכולים לחפש רק עם 1 ו- 0, אך CAM טרניארי מוסיף "X" לתמהיל כך שהנתונים לא צריכים להתאים בדיוק, מה שמוסיף לגמישות שלהם. זה הופך אותו לאידיאלי לאחסון רשימות בקרת גישה (ACL) במתגים ונתבים ברמה ארגונית מכיוון שניתן לחפש אותו בשדה רחב יותר, מה שהופך את החיפוש לגמיש יותר. לדוגמה, ניתן לחפש מגוון שלם של כתובות IP בו זמנית במקום להשוות את כל התוכן בזה אחר זה. זה שימושי להגדלת מהירות בדיקת המסלול, העברת מנות, סיווג מנות ופקודות מבוססות ACL.

אפילו עם היתרונות שלה, TCAM משמש לעיתים רחוקות בתעשיית האלקטרוניקה מכיוון שהוא יקר לבנות וצורך הרבה כוח, אשר הופך לאחר מכן לחום, וכתוצאה מכך דרישות כוח נוספות לקירור.

מהו זיכרון טרניארי הניתן לניתוק-תוכן (tcam)? - הגדרה מטכנולוגיה